Sorry for pushing this thread, but how safe is it to pay via PayPal on Kinguin? I'm just a little worried.

5 years ago
Permalink

Comment has been collapsed.

From my experience very safe, because:

  • I rarely had an invalid key/wrong game (happens way more often at G2A)
  • if I had to ask for a refund, I always got it back directly by Kinguin (I never used buyer protection, they probably only react faster then), you should take screenshots ofc
  • even if they would decline the refund, you could still use PayPal's buyer protection and they usually decide in favor of the buyer
  • if you're using a credit card for your PP account, you would have another possibility to cancel the payment

Additionally, Kinguin doesn't take a payment fee for PP anymore (contrary to G2A and other key sellers).
One reason against buying there is that the devs don't profit as they do from official resellers. But if you're asking in regard of Prey (2006), you don't have any other possibility.
And I suggest to buy only from key sellers, if you plan to use the key/gift for yourself. When giving away / trading, you can't take screenshots yourself at first and it might take too much time (risking the deadline of buyer's protection).

I see. Since the game is removed from the Steam store, Valve can't blame you for buying a key (and they usually wouldn't even know the origin). Furthermore, if it's only about one game, the reaction should be to just remove that game from your account again.
There are always rumours about banned accounts due to VPN using or credit card fraud, but they're rumours and if you're not using VPN to bypass regional price differences directly at the Steam store or using suspiciously cheap Steam gift cards, your account shouldn't be at risk.
I usually prefer official resellers, but since I'm collecting removed games, I bought more than hundred games at key sellers and nothing bad happened. I activated several games which aren't available in Germany by using VPN and nothing bad happened. The few game revocations I had were based on payment issues between bundle sites (especially Otaku..) and devs/publishers or due to ending of alpha/beta phases.
